Step 4: Re-baseline checkout load tests. After migrating QuillCart to the v3 payment gateway, the old LoadForge scenarios are invalid — session tokens and cart endpoints changed. Run the updated scenario pack against staging first and confirm p95 latency stays under the Dunmore SLO before touching prod schedules. If alerts fire mid-run, pause the generator rather than killing it. The scenario pack expects the settings shown below.

settings of yahaf-tahop:
jorox:
  pin: 5851
  tenant: noveth
  seal: seal_7ddb5c42
  metrics_host: metrics.jorox.ordinnet.example
  standby_team: wenax
  escalation: oliath-feneth
  nonce: 552548

Review note for the Veridex validator plugin system ahead of the 4.2 cut. The registry now lazy-loads plugins and caches compiled schemas per tenant, which removed the startup stall Priya flagged. One concern: the retry wrapper around plugin discovery uses hardcoded values that should move into config before release. Nothing blocks the merge, but the release notes should call out the new limits. The constants we settled on are below.

tuning constants:
QUOTAS = {
    "druwyn": 5,
    "holix": 5,
    "zorath": 5,
    "holwyn": 10,
}

Ticket: Staging env misconfigured for Siftgate bloom filter

The bloom layer in front of the Pellet KV store is rejecting all lookups in staging because the env file was copied from the dev template without credentials. False-positive tuning values are fine; only the auth line is missing. To unblock the weekly demo, the Pellet admission secret must be set on the following line.

env line for yaguf-fajop: LEDGER_TOKEN13=fb08984397349